Bought an E6600 and a DFI 975X mobo about a month ago. Max speed I could run on the DFI was 3.2GHz because the board just refuses to go higher than 360 FSB -- it's a well known issue. (But I'm stuck @ 333 because it won't cold boot at any higher) BIOS updates just make issues worse.
So, what do I do, I decide to plunk $180 down for a new mobo that's supposed to break those FSB limits... Maybe I can really see what this proc is capable of?? I buy a P5B-E -- a brand new revision C2 965 mobo. Set the thing up hoping this will be a better board than the flawed DFI. Guess what? IT'S WORSE!
On the P5B-E, I cannot even post at 333 FSB! Max I was able to get was 315FSB....
REALLLLLY disappointing. Such a waste of money.
Am I missing something here?? I disabled ALL onboard devices, tried it with only one stick of memory (Patriot 1GB 667MHz), disabled all fancy CPU options like C1E, etc, set the memory timings to the loosest possible and using the biggest divider I could, set Vcore to 1.4, Memory voltage to 2.0, locked PCI-E to 100MHz, PCI to 33.3, etc. I even downloaded the latest BIOS for the board. Nothing helps.
I can't think of anything else to do. I so wanted this board to be better than the DFI, but as it stands, the Asus is just plain worse.
